ONION: Gladalan

  • Developed in the 1920s at the Gladalan nursery in Armadale, Western Australia, by Glad and Alan Brown.
  • Appearance: Produces medium to large, globe-shaped bulbs up to 15cm in diameter with a shiny, straw-brown papery skin and white, crisp flesh.
  • Flavor: Mild, rich flavour suitable for cooking, including roasting, frying, and stews.
  • Variety Type: Short to medium-day variety, making it exceptionally well-suited to warmer climates, including Australian subtropical regions, but adaptable elsewhere
  • When to Sow: In Australia, sowing typically occurs in Autumn (April to June) to ensure bulb development before hot weather.
  • Harvest Time: Approximately 15–18 weeks (110–130 days) after sowing, or when the tops turn yellow and droop.
  • Germination: Takes 7–14 days, with best results at 19-21°C.
